Zhu Wei’s ‘Utopia, No.46’: A Meditation on Devotion in the Shadow of Change
This captivating artwork by Zhu Wei, titled ‘Utopia, No.46’, presents a scene brimming with quiet contemplation and subtle tension. Measuring 120 x 120 cm, the painting immediately draws the eye to its meticulously rendered figures – twelve individuals seated in rows, their heads bowed in what appears to be a deeply reverent gathering. The vibrant palette, dominated by rich reds punctuated by diverse clothing styles and hairstyles, creates an atmosphere both celebratory and subtly unsettling. The artist’s skillful use of color and form speaks volumes about the complexities of Chinese art during this period, reflecting a nation grappling with rapid modernization while clinging to centuries-old traditions.

Historical Context and Symbolism
Created by Zhu Wei in an unknown date, ‘Utopia, No.46’ was produced during a pivotal moment in Chinese history – the post-Tiananmen era. The artist's background as a former military artist, trained within the People’s Liberation Army Art Academy, informs his work with a nuanced understanding of state-sanctioned art and its role in shaping public perception. The scene itself can be interpreted through multiple lenses: it could represent traditional religious practices, an attempt to instill discipline and obedience, or perhaps a critique of societal conformity. The red curtains, a common element in Chinese theatre and ceremonies, further amplify the painting’s symbolic weight.
